This software (CMVS) takes the output of a structure-from-motion (SfM) software as input, then decomposes the input images into a set of image clusters of managable size. This is a modified version of CMVS/PMVS.

Main modification:
 - cross platform compilation Linux, Windows => CMake build system generator.
 - added bug fix from Nghia Ho.
 - make PLY, PSET, PATCH export faster and optional.
 - Replaced GSL simplex/lmfit with nlopt optimizer
 - Replaced image loading routines with CImg. Now PPMs are supported properly, with optional support for PNG and TIFF
 - Replaced BLAS/LAPACK with Eigen
 - Updated internal jpeg library and miniBoost
 - CMake-system now supports system boost, jpeg and other libraries if available. 
 - Replaced pthread with tinycthread to get rid of pthread.dll on Windows
